Hollywood Beach (RPCX800129) is a 1956 Pullman Standard Company built 5 Double Bedroom Lounge built for the Seaboard Air Line for service on its flagship train, “The Silver Meteor”. It is the sole survivor of three identical cars for which this car was briefly re-named “Sun Ray” in 1967 after the merger of the Atlantic Coast Line Railroad to form Seaboard Coast Line.
Amtrak inherited the car and its last regular service was in 1981. After a series various owners it was acquired by Keith R. White in 2016 and was lovingly restored to ambience and charm it never held before. Gateway Rail Services of Madison, IL, installed all new glass, new plumbing, new electrical wiring and a new generator.
It has a full kitchen in the middle of the car and is equipped with electrical out-lets throughout. It features a Bose Sound System, a 39 inch television, DVD player and is WiFi equipped as well! The car sleeps 10 and features a beautiful shower and general water closet as well as toilet facilities in four of the rooms for which can be configured into suites sleeping four, if desired!
